Search Everything

New domain at   https://dylan.watch

Li Ying Chao

Li Ying Chao

Personal information

Birthday

2001-01-09

Movies and TV shows :

poster

Falling Into Your Smile

2021

8.0

TV
poster

Super Nova Games

2018

7.0

TV
poster

The King of Comedy

2016

0.0

TV
poster

打歌2025

2025

0.0

TV
poster

百分百开麦

2022

0.0

TV